Output 81e2516d388ed4b5b7c84a5bbaa40fd094241f7d983cb8333b8a5dcafe562de1:0

value
96519
script pubkey
OP_HASH160 OP_PUSHBYTES_20 de9a27541312b7b91c74916d5e37d249dab868a9 OP_EQUAL
address
3Mz2buqjzqts1sbww49Jow85AB5UzEUT2x
transaction
81e2516d388ed4b5b7c84a5bbaa40fd094241f7d983cb8333b8a5dcafe562de1
confirmations
302435
spent
true